Environmental management policy

The Environmental Management Policy indicates the basic policy regarding environmental management and initiatives based on the TOREI Group's business philosophy, and has been established as a pledge to society. In addition to our basic philosophy, our environmental management policy specifies the activities and fields we will focus on based on our own business activities, which will lead to the formulation of medium- and long-term activity plans and goals. We review our environmental management policy at the end of each fiscal year and consider the need for revisions. Additionally, we have separately formulated ``Environmental Management Goals'' and ``Environmental Management Plans'' as specific action plans for realizing our environmental management policy.

Environmental management policy

● Basic philosophy

Recognizing that companies that do not consider the global environment cannot survive, we strive to contribute to the development of a better society, and strive to protect the global environment in all of our corporate activities, including purchasing, processing, manufacturing, storage, logistics, sales, and services. We will work proactively and sincerely to preserve and improve the quality of our products.

● Priority areas for environmental initiatives

  1. 1. We will always be aware of the environmental aspects of our business activities, promote the reduction of environmental loads including greenhouse gas emissions, and strive to continuously improve sustainable management.
  2. 2. Comply with environmental laws and regulations, and act in accordance with international codes of conduct. Understand and analyze environmental risks associated with business activities, such as violations of environmental laws and regulations and environmental accidents, formulate response policies for those risks, and develop rules and systems as necessary.
  3. 3. Regarding the reduction of the environmental impact associated with business activities, we will work on the following basic principles, set action goals for each item that are rooted in corporate activities, and promote environmental activities with all employees.
    1. ① Strive for efficient use of resources such as electricity, water, and materials, and reduce usage.
    2. ② Take preventive measures to prevent pollutants exceeding standard values from leaking outside.
    3. ③ We will reduce the amount of residue generated during the production process and promote recycling.
    4. ④ Ascertain the amount of chemical substances used and strive to manage them appropriately.
    5. ⑤ Understand the amount of energy used in product storage and logistics and work to reduce it.
    6. ⑥ Prevent leakage of refrigerants used in refrigeration equipment, and select natural refrigerant equipment when updating major equipment.
    7. ⑦ By taking the above steps, we will reduce greenhouse gas emissions.
  4. 4. Be aware that our business activities benefit from biological resources, including marine resources, and strive to reduce the impact on biodiversity, contribute to its conservation, and make sustainable use of all resources. Strive to.
  5. 5. Raise the environmental awareness of everyone working in or for this organization, engage in environmental activities, cooperate with local communities and society, and disclose corporate information regarding sustainable management and the environment in a timely and appropriate manner. and promote communication and collaboration with diverse stakeholders.
  6. 6. Conduct an internal audit once a year to confirm the implementation status of this policy.

eco action 21

TOREI and TFL (*) have obtained EcoAction 21 certification, which is Japan's unique Environmental Management System (EMS) established by the Ministry of the Environment, and each year their compliance with the requirements is evaluated by a third party. By incorporating EcoAction 21's Environmental Management System, we not only comply with environmental laws, but also create a system for continuous situation improvement, prepare manuals for environmental measures, and improve internal environmental awareness. This not only improves performance, but also has a ripple effect on stakeholders outside the company.

(*)Toyo Refrigerated Food & Logistics Co., Ltd.
